摘要
An overview on the application and achievements of physico-mathematical modeling of metallurgical processes in China is briefly declared. The important role of coefficients in model formulation is shown from our experience. The mass transfer coefficients of the slag-metal reactions and the gas-metal reactions are discussed referring to the flow conditions near the interface. The influence of the surface-active species on the mass transfer and the interfacial reaction is also discussed briefly.
